The Benefits of Indoor Sports Wood Flooring for Athletes

Indoor sports wood flooring offers a multitude of benefits for athletes, ranging from enhanced safety and performance to improved comfort and aesthetics. Here are some of the key benefits that make indoor sports wood flooring the preferred choice for sports venues.

One of the primary benefits of indoor sports wood flooring is its shock-absorbing properties. As mentioned earlier, the flooring is designed to absorb and distribute the impact of jumps, landings, and other high-impact movements, reducing the stress on athletes' joints and muscles. This helps to minimize the risk of injuries such as sprains, fractures, and concussions, allowing athletes to perform at their best without fear of getting hurt.

In addition to its shock-absorbing properties, indoor sports wood flooring also offers excellent traction. The surface is engineered to provide just the right amount of grip, allowing athletes to move quickly and confidently without slipping or falling. This is particularly important in sports like basketball and volleyball, where quick changes of direction and sudden stops are common.

Another benefit of indoor sports wood flooring is its comfort. The natural warmth and resilience of wood make it a more comfortable surface to play on than concrete or other hard materials. This can help to reduce fatigue and improve overall performance, allowing athletes to train and compete for longer periods without feeling tired or sore.

Aesthetically, indoor sports wood flooring adds a touch of elegance and sophistication to any sports venue. The natural beauty of wood creates a warm and inviting atmosphere, making athletes and spectators feel more at home. This can help to enhance the overall experience of attending a sports event, making it more enjoyable and memorable.

Finally, indoor sports wood flooring is also more environmentally friendly than many other types of flooring. Wood is a renewable resource that can be sustainably harvested and processed, reducing the environmental impact of sports venues. Additionally, many manufacturers offer eco-friendly finishes and adhesives that further reduce the flooring's carbon footprint.
